Vantyx Flow is field software for licensed insurance agents. It handles two kinds of information: details about the agents who use it, and details about the people those agents enroll. This page explains what we collect, why, who we share it with, and what you can ask us to do about it.

The short version. We collect what the app needs to do its job and nothing else. We do not sell personal information. We do not show ads. We do not use client data to train AI models. Photographs of insurance applications are deleted the moment the information is read off them.

3.3 What we deliberately do not collect

The application scanner reads a limited, fixed list of fields from a photographed form. Social Security numbers and driver’s licence numbers are never extracted and never stored, even when they are visible on the page.

4. Camera, photos, and location

4.1 Camera

The app uses the camera for three things: scanning raffle or lead cards, photographing insurance applications so the details can be read off them automatically, and taking a profile photo.

Photographs of applications and raffle cards are not stored. The image is sent for reading, the extracted fields are returned, and the image file is deleted from the device immediately afterwards. It is not saved to your photo library, not uploaded to our servers, and not retained by us in any form.

4.2 Photo library

Used only if you choose an existing photo as your profile picture.

4.3 Location

Vantyx Flow uses location only while the app is open. The app does not track location in the background, does not follow agents during the day, and does not build a location history.

Whether location is required depends on your agency. Confirming that an agent is physically on-site is central to how the product works: claims, check-ins and on-site sessions are built around it. Each agency chooses whether to enforce that check. Where it is enforced, declining the permission or turning it off later will stop you starting an on-site session. Where an agency has turned it off, the rest of the app works normally without it.

Either way, location is read only at the moment you start a session, to confirm you are at the institution. It is never read in the background.

6. Automated reading of application forms

When an agent photographs an application, the image is sent to Anthropic, PBC to read the printed and handwritten fields. Only the fields the app needs are returned. The image is discarded once the reading is complete.

Anthropic does not use data submitted through its business API to train its models. We do not use client information to train any model of our own.

Nothing in the app makes a decision about a person automatically. Underwriting decisions are made by the insurance carrier, not by Vantyx Flow.

10. Security

Traffic between the app and our servers is encrypted in transit. Data is encrypted at rest. Access is restricted by role: agents see their own work and, where their agency has enabled it, work shared with them; agency leadership sees agency-wide figures. These restrictions are enforced on the server, not only in the app.

Passwords are stored as one-way hashes. We cannot read them. The app supports Face ID or fingerprint unlock on supported devices.

No system is perfectly secure. If a breach affects your information, we will notify affected parties and the relevant authorities as required by law.

12. Children

Vantyx Flow is not directed at children and we do not knowingly collect information from anyone under 18 as a user of the app.

Some insurance products cover children, and an agent may record a child’s name and date of birth as the person insured on a policy taken out by a parent or guardian. That information is supplied by the adult applicant on a signed insurance application. It is held as part of the policy record and used only to service that policy.
